Description

The c.73-2A>T variant has not been reported in individuals with hereditary paragangliomas and pheochromocytomas and was absent from large population studies. This variant occurs in the invariant region (+/- 1,2) of the splice consensus sequence and is predicted to cause altered splicing leading to an abnormal or absent protein. Heterozygous loss of funtion of the SDHB gene is an established disease mechanism in hereditary paragangliomas and pheochromocytomas. In summary, although additional studies are required to fully establish its clinical significance, the c.73-2A>T variant is likely pathogenic.
